Cal State East Bay vs. Temple Cost Comparison

Which college is more expensive, Cal State East Bay or Temple?

  • Temple University is 252% more expensive to attend than Cal State East Bay for in-state tuition ($20,211.00 vs. $5,742.00)
  • Out of state tuition is 96.8% higher at Temple than California State University East Bay ($34,684.00 vs. $17,622.00)
  • The typical actual cost that students pay to attend (average net price) is less at California State University East Bay than Temple ($11,464 vs. $23,935)
  • Living costs (room and board or off-campus housing budget) at California State University East Bay are 1.6% lower than costs at Temple University ($15,402 vs. $15,648)
  • More students receive financial grant aid at Temple University than California State University East Bay (88% vs. 76%)
  • The average total grant financial aid received by Temple University students is 33.7% larger than aid received California State University East Bay ($11,575 vs. $8,659)

Cal State East Bay vs. Temple Graduation Outcomes Comparison

Which is better, Cal State East Bay or Temple? Graduation rate, salary and amount of student loan debt are indicators of a college which offers better outcomes for its graduates. Compare the following outcomes facts between Temple and Cal State East Bay.

  • The graduation rate at Temple is higher than California State University East Bay (68% vs. 43%)
  • Graduates from Temple University earn on average $1,000 more per year than Cal State East Bay graduates after ten years. ($56,300 vs. $55,300)
  • California State University East Bay students graduate with a $9,668 lower median federal student loan debt than Temple graduates. ($16,332 vs. $26,000)
  • Cal State East Bay graduates are paying $100 less per month on federal student loans than Temple graduates. ($168 vs. $268)
  • More Temple graduates are actively paying back their federal student loan debt than former Cal State East Bay students, three years after graduation. (69% vs. 61%)
